Output 51fb50a17838a10ca68b5b1910a5ca768ad603020c1ee17b14b408235e72bfc0:0

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886447fb05bdbb115a682352f5c8ba3081a5f1c0 OP_EQUAL
address
3E8BxHpZ9w1GHZy6wY9NLCFa5vLB7UxAtS
transaction
51fb50a17838a10ca68b5b1910a5ca768ad603020c1ee17b14b408235e72bfc0
spent
true